spring mvc 定时器类怎么调用@service
答案:2 悬赏:40 手机版
解决时间 2021-12-26 07:37
- 提问者网友:送舟行
- 2021-12-25 11:01
spring mvc 定时器类怎么调用@service
最佳答案
- 五星知识达人网友:千夜
- 2021-12-25 11:35
什么定时器 在什么环境中的 。。。。。。。。。
全部回答
- 1楼网友:傲气稳了全场
- 2021-12-25 11:56
有两种流行spring定时器配置:java的timer类和opensymphony的quartz。
1.java timer定时
首先继承java.util.timertask类实现run方法
import java.util.timertask;
public class emailreporttask extends timertask{
@override
public void run() {
...
}
}
在spring定义
...
配置spring定时器
86400000value>
property>
bean>
timertask属性告诉scheduledtimertask运行哪个。86400000代表24个小时
启动spring定时器
spring的timerfactorybean负责启动定时任务
- list>
property>
bean>
scheduledtimertasks里显示一个需要启动的定时器任务的列表。
可以通过设置delay属性延迟启动
我要举报
如以上问答信息为低俗、色情、不良、暴力、侵权、涉及违法等信息,可以点下面链接进行举报!
大家都在看
推荐资讯